Output 886a404f7310c0c3ad79293245256aecfdfff06fc35ede7b25cc76df0410a75b:0

value
30505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aee51343b858d28b1040b930e7c18cf0006dc3f OP_EQUAL
address
38XDRJryzhq3y1aaLxmmFPANJDTpnErUWu
transaction
886a404f7310c0c3ad79293245256aecfdfff06fc35ede7b25cc76df0410a75b
spent
true